L Shaped Beds For Small Rooms

L-shaped bunk beds as well as loft beds can be perfect for rooms with small children. They can provide more sleeping space than traditional bunks and are more convenient to move around in.

The Lifetime Kids Corner Beach House bed with bench is an ideal place to read and cuddle. The bed folds out to form a futon so it is perfect for sleepovers.

Twin bed with L-shaped

The L-shaped Twin Bed provides two separate sleeping areas, while saving floor space. This type of bunk bed comprises two beds that are set in the shape of an L, with one of them stacked perpendicular to the other. Some bunks with a L shape have additional features like desks and storage. Bunk beds are available in different styles, from traditional to amazing themed bunks which are perfect for adventurous kids.

L-shaped loft bed with desk

If your children require an area for work that is designated to do their schoolwork, an L shaped bunk bed with desks is the ideal solution. This design allows kids to use the top bunk as desk space while the lower one can be used as a comfy bed. This type of bunk bed with desk will aid in keeping kids organized and motivated to learn while preserving valuable floor space in their bedroom.

Although many children can safely occupy the upper bunk of an L-shaped or loft bunk, UK guidelines recommend that this bed is only used by children aged six years and older. Similar to lofts and bunks, loft beds with stairs should only be used by children who are capable of climbing safely.
